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Datchet to Wombwell start from as little as £21.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Datchet to Wombwell start from £76.10 one way, or £120.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Datchet to Wombwell are available for £148.10 one way, or £290.20 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Datchet Train Station, though small, is equipped with essential amenities to facilitate a comfortable journey. Ticketing is straightforward with the choice to purchase from the ticket office, which operates Monday to Friday from 06:00 to 12:00 and on Saturdays from 08:00 to 13:00. For those purchasing tickets online, collection can be made seamlessly at the accessible ticket machine, which supports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Although lacking in physical assistance, a helpful point is available for guidance, complemented by live departure screens providing real-time train information.

Accessibility is a point of note at Datchet, with step-free access available through varying gradients and routes, ensuring travelers can navigate effectively. While the station supports mobility-impaired passengers boarding with assistance from train guards—who step onto the platform to provide help—the facilities do lack certain conveniences like waiting rooms, seating areas, and fully accessible toilets.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Wombwell train station operates without a staffed ticket office, but don't let that deter you. With ticket machines available to purchase and collect pre-booked tickets, obtaining your pass for a journey has never been easier. In terms of technology, induction loops ensure clear announcements for all passengers. Despite the absence of accessible ticket machines, the station does cater to passengers with reduced mobility through step-free access—albeit via steep ramps and road bridges. This level of access makes it a Category B, scooter-friendly station, proving that accessibility doesn’t always mean compromise.

For assistance, while there is no permanent staff on site, help is available both through using the station's help points or contacting the provided helpline at 08002006060. Boarding ramps and other assistance services can be arranged with relatively short notice, so planning a hassle-free trip is well within reach.

Amenities and Parking

If you’re planning to leave your vehicle at the station, feel reassured with the knowledge that Wombwell offers free parking—albeit very limited with just six spaces available. However, note the absence of dedicated accessible parking spaces. The station is not lavish with amenities either; lacking in-refreshments, ATMs, and shops. If you were hoping to log on to WiFi during your wait, you may need to rely on mobile data as public internet access is unavailable here. Getting Around Wombwell

For those venturing beyond Wombwell, transport links extend the reach of the station further into diverse destinations. Convenient bus services operate close to the station, a reliable alternative for onward travel. Rail replacement services ensure continued connectivity, with pick-up and drop-off in the station's car park. Though bicycle hire is not available directly at the station, you've got on-platform bicycle storage under CCTV watch, adding an extra touch of practicality.
